Rafflesia arnoldii, the corpse flower or giant padma, is a species of flowering plant in the parasitic genus Rafflesia. It is noted for producing the largest individual flower on Earth. It has a strong and unpleasant odor of decaying flesh. It is native to the rainforests of Sumatra and Borneo.

Taxonomy is a branch of biology centered around classifying animals into living groups. This is done based on the differences and similarities between animals. Taxa in the Linnaean system include kingdom, phylum, class, order, family, genus, and species. Between these relations it all stems from common ancestry. Which is what can relate species to others. The cells in our bodies need oxygen to stay alive. Carbon dioxide is made in our bodies as cells do their jobs. The lungs and respiratory system allow oxygen in the air to be taken into the body, while also letting the body get rid of carbon dioxide in the air breathed out.
